# Who to Contact: Vendoring Third-Party Fonts

Plugin authors distributing fonts with Tessellate extensions must vendor them under `assets/fonts/` and include the license text alongside. Do not hotlink to external foundries; the plugin gallery build rejects remote font fetches. Licensing questions are handled by the Typography Review rotation at Lumenport, not the plugin gallery team. Reviews typically take three business days. To start a license review or ask about an ambiguous font license, write to the rotation inbox.

alerts address for bafog-tawep: ulavan_sorwyn_fraax@kelviworks.local

Connection pooling at Quartzline is handled by the Poolmaster sidecar. Each service gets a fixed pool sized from the capacity sheet; do not raise limits without checking replica headroom on the Ashdown cluster. Idle connections are reaped after five minutes. Pool config changes ship through the standard release pipeline, and the config bundle must be signed before rollout. Sign it with the deploy key below:

rollout seal: bky4_x7Gc

Current terms are above prevailing market rates for the Ellsworth district by an estimated 11%. We have opened renegotiation with the landlord, Cormant Properties, seeking a rent reduction, a refurbishment contribution, and a five-year break clause. Finance should model three scenarios: renewal at revised terms, partial downsizing to two floors, and full relocation. Updated occupancy costs are in the shared model. Strategic context appears in the restricted note below.

board note of tadup-tajog: Headcount on the Oliiel team goes from 31 to 88 by the end of February. Gross margin on Oliiel came in at 62 percent against a plan of 29 percent.